Pros

Excellent work ethics and work culture Employees are friendly (in front of your face) Work life balance (only to those who are good in buttering manager) Free food Free cabs

Cons

Walmart is a very big organisation that holds a good reputation in the market. It is a dream company for many of the youngsters. But the management over here is very unpredictable. Managers and team leads involves in team politics. Being a big brand doesnt guarantee you any type of job security. Their will be a fear of loosing your job at any time. You need to take unnecessary leave approvals even if you are in some family emergency or you woke up sick in the morning. One of the worst policy ever i have seen in a brand. Hr is useless. One of the worst hr ever i had experienced. Always involved in team politics. Doesnt even bothered about discussing any company benefits and policies to the new entrant. They believe in referal hiring due to which talented people wont get the opportunity which spoils the work environment. Team leads itself dont have any important work apart from playing politics.

Pros

Cab facility, free Lunch, nice pantry, flexible working hours, team outings every quarter

Cons

Calling people's manager as engineering manager, no proper vision for future, not much learning from the project, interview standards are going down in the need of hiring too many people, no proper roadmap, worklife will be disturbed a lot duing oncall time
